Position Overview

We are seeking a Compounding Operator to join a manufacturing operation in Largo, FL. This is a hands-on production position responsible for preparing and mixing resin batches according to detailed formulations, operating compounding equipment, performing quality inspections, packaging finished products, and maintaining accurate production records.

Candidates with experience in manufacturing, machine operation, plastics, chemical processing, compounding, blending, mixing, injection molding, or other industrial production environments are encouraged to apply.

Key Responsibilities
  • Prepare batches of resins using detailed formulations and mix sheets, including pre-blending raw materials.

  • Accurately weigh and load ingredients into ribbon blenders and drum tumblers according to formulation specifications.

  • Perform start-up, shutdown, and routine maintenance of 40mm and 60mm compo under lines and associated water systems.

  • Weigh, package, and label finished products according to work order specifications.

  • Perform routine production maintenance on compounders, pelletizers, dryers, and water systems.

  • Disassemble compounding equipment for screen changes and cleaning.

  • Troubleshoot equipment and production issues.

  • Operate and maintain associated equipment used in the production of compounds.

  • Collect compound samples and mold ASTM slabs as required for each work order.

  • Visually inspect products for defects and initiate corrective action when necessary.

  • Accurately enter production and quality data into applicable computer systems.

  • Complete manufacturing documentation, work orders, stock movement tickets, scrap tickets, identification tags, and other required paperwork.

  • Communicate production status, equipment issues, and other important information between shifts.

  • Assist with training employees on proper production techniques and procedures.

  • Maintain a clean, safe, and organized work area.

  • Follow all established safety procedures and wear required personal protective equipment (PPE).

  • Perform additional production-related duties as assigned.
